Role overview
This position is based in Virginia, County Cavan, and sits within Tirlán’s maintenance function. The role focuses on organising, coordinating, and sequencing all on-site maintenance activity, while also working with outside contractors for repairs and related maintenance work. The successful candidate will manage maintenance teams and external vendors day to day, reporting to the Engineering Manager.
Tirlán is a global food and nutrition co-operative with a wide range of ingredients, consumer brands, and agri brands. The organisation operates across Ireland, the US, the MEA region, and China, with annual revenue of more than €3 billion and a workforce of over 2,300 people supporting 11 processing plants and 52 agri branches. Its purpose is to help nourish the world while protecting the environment for future generations.
Key responsibilities
- Comply with all plant health, safety, and environmental rules at all times.
- Escalate actual or potential hazards to the line manager without delay.
- Wear the required personal protective equipment at all times and refer to the correct SOPs when needed.
- Review and follow the relevant SOPs for every task and ensure full compliance.
- Act as the main point of contact between maintenance and the rest of the plant.
- Receive work requests from departments, check that each request includes all necessary details, and review them with the engineering team.
- Coordinate with production to identify downtime windows for maintenance execution.
- Build preventive maintenance and demand maintenance work into the production schedule.
- Work with the engineering team to plan manpower and resources for safe, timely completion of work.
- Assign and prioritise work orders across individual crafts.
- Define the full scope of maintenance jobs, including repair, preventive, and predictive tasks, and add QA requirements where relevant.
- Carry out field walkdowns when needed to spot hazards and identify permit requirements.
- Determine any special tools or equipment needed for the job.
- Coordinate with stores staff to source or hire parts, equipment, and services required for maintenance work.
- Maintain accurate equipment history and job records.
- Ensure new equipment is entered into the maintenance system and that associated preventive maintenance plans are created.
- Process change control requests for equipment modifications.
- Track, report, and display KPIs related to equipment reliability and maintenance performance.
- Continuously improve planning, scheduling, data handling, and job reporting processes to increase efficiency.
- Prepare maintenance reports for engineering teams on equipment performance over defined periods.
- Distribute the planned maintenance schedule to relevant departments in a timely manner.
- Work with engineering, finance, and stores teams to monitor and control the engineering budget.
- Take part in shutdown planning and preparation meetings and ensure all shutdown work orders are logged and tracked.
- Coordinate contractor activity with engineers and contractors, and issue PMs and DMs for work completed on site.
- Report monthly spend for the area to the engineering team.
- Support the Engineering Manager with budget planning and control.
- Support other engineers with project cost control.
- Adapt to updates in GMP, EHS, technical, new equipment, and quality procedures and SOPs.
- Carry out other duties requested by the direct manager as needed.
